How should flux be applied?

How should flux be applied?

Use a small paintbrush or your fingers to scoop up a small amount of soldering flux. Spread the flux over the area you will be soldering, making sure to cover the wires fully. Wipe any excess flux off your fingers or brush before soldering. Soldering flux is only corrosive once it is heated up and in its liquid form.

What is the approximate time to wait for the solder to melt during the process of soldering?

Considering the time it takes the solder iron to heat the lead, the board and the solder it can take up to 1 to 3 seconds to do this, depending upon the total metallic mass of the solder joint to be created.

How does the soldering process work?

Soldering is a process used for joining metal parts to form a mechanical or electrical bond. It typically uses a low melting point metal alloy (solder) which is melted and applied to the metal parts to be joined and this bonds to the metal parts and forms a connection when the solder solidifies.

What is the purpose of flux in soldering electronic circuit components?

In soldering of metals, flux serves a threefold purpose: it removes any oxidized metal from the surfaces to be soldered, seals out air thus preventing further oxidation, and by facilitating amalgamation improves wetting characteristics of the liquid solder.

Do you need flux to solder electronics?

Do you need to use flux when soldering? When soldering circuit boards, or other electrical / electronic devices, yes – you need to use flux. Fortunately, almost all solder for electronics use has an internal core of flux, so you usually don’t need to add more.

How long should solder cool electronics?

Solder won’t fill spots that are cooler than its melting point. Fill the joint until solder drips out, then move on to the next joint. Give the joint 30 to 45 seconds to cool and harden before putting pressure on it. Be careful; it’ll still be too hot to touch.

What kind of flux do you use for soldering?

Solder attaches more easily to non-oxidized metal, which will cause the solder to flow evenly on the electrical lead. Since the solder is even in the electrical lead its electrical conductivity is also improved. There are three main types of fluxes in use today: rosin flux, organic acid flux, and inorganic acid flux.

What temperature should a soldering iron be set at?

Turn on the soldering iron and set temperature above the melting point of your solder. 600°- 650°F (316°- 343°C) is a good place to start for lead-based solder and 650°- 700°F (343°- 371°C) for lead-free solder. Hold the tip against both the lead and contact point/pad for a few seconds.

What do you need to solder a connector to a pad?

When soldering an electronic connector to a contact point (often called a “pad”), you generally need the following: A soldering iron capable of reaching the melting point of the solder. Wire solder, with or without a flux core. Flux, if the wire solder does not include a flux core or if additional flux is needed.

What is inorganic flux used for in electrical circuits?

Inorganic flux is used on stronger metals such as copper and stainless steel. It is not commonly used in electrical circuits, instead being used mainly for plumbing applications. There is solder is available with flux inside the wire, called flux core solder.
